Brad Pitt recreates his mythical scene at Wimbledon: "Nobody eats better in the history of cinema"

Yesterday, after several weeks and endless matches, the Wimbledon championship came to an end in Great Britain, the official tennis tournament organized since 1877 by the All England Lawn Tennis and the Croquet Club.

The young Spanish tennis player Carlos Alcaraz was proclaimed champion of the competition for the first time after waging an epic final against Novak Djokovic. The 20-year-old from Murcia thus became the youngest winner of the tournament in the last 37 years and ranks as one of the strongest tennis players in the world.

Although Alcaraz made history and has the whole world celebrating his victory and waiting for his next steps, there were other protagonists of the sporting event that did not go unnoticed among the audience present in the stadium.

Members of the British royal family such as Kate Middleton and Prince William, the Spanish monarch Felipe VI or the actors Hugh Jackman and Brad Pitt were some of the public figures who attended the event.

Although the actor from Les Miserables or The Great Showman caused a stir by uploading a photo with the king of our country, Angelina Jolie's ex got all the attention due to his enviable physique at 59 years of age.
